      Morocco VS Haiti Morocco and Brazil are tied on 4 points in Group C of the 2026 World Cup. A draw will see Morocco through, but to top the group and overtake Brazil, they need to win by at least 3 goals. So, they are highly motivated to score as many goals as possible. On the other hand, Haiti has lost both of their games and are already out of the competition with 0 points. They are only playing for their first World - Cup goal in history. Their captain and goalkeeper, Placide, is having his last international game. Morocco, ranked 7th in the world with a total squad value of 440 million euros, has a well - established 4 - 2 - 3 - 1 possession - based system. Hakimi and Mazraoui, two full - backs from top clubs, drive the attack, while Bounou guards the goal. Only the center - back Aguerd and winger Abde are injured, and the core of the team is intact.
